PURPOSE: To prepare a oil-in-water type emulsion composition having low viscosity, suppressed tendency of fatty acid crystallization, and excellent stability and feeling to the skin, and useful as cosmetics, by compounding a specific α-monoglycerine ether to an emulsion obtained by the reaction of a basic amino acid with a higher fatty acid or beeswax.
CONSTITUTION: An oil-in-water type emulsion obtained by reacting (A) a basic amino acid (pref. L-arginine or L-lysine) with (B) a 14W22C higher fatty acid or beeswax, is mixed with (C) 0.1W2 parts by weight, pref. 0.2W1.5 parts, based on 1 part of the (B) component, of an α-monoglycerine ether of formula [R is ≥16C alcohol residue (pref. 16W18C saturated straight-chain alcohol residue or 24W44C saturated alcohol residue having a side chain at β-position)]. Since the ether of the formula has a low viscosity, and nevertheless suppresses the crystallization of the fatty acid, a stable emulsion having excellent feeling to the skin can be prepared.
